His words calmed Gu Yusheng down. After a while, he said in an indifferent tone, "I don't know."

"But …" Gu Yusheng only said two words before his eyebrows twitched and he stopped.

The person who had corresponded with him was called "A."

From A's letters, it seemed that Gu Yusheng had taken the initiative to send the letters to A.

In his impression, there seemed to be nothing missing in his memory. However, he had always been a little confused. Why had he taken the initiative to write letters to A?

Because of his family, he had never liked to tell others what was on his mind, and he also felt that it was difficult to talk about it. Maybe he had used the pseudonym "S" because he had simply wanted to find a pen pal who had nothing to do with him to vent his worries.

However, no matter what, that pen pal called Little A had accompanied him for seven years … Even though Mr. S and Little A had never met and didn't know each other, during the long years that they had spent together, Little A had given Mr. S a lot of real and subtle warmth …

Gu Yusheng tilted his head thoughtfully and stared out of the window, as if he was seriously thinking about an adjective. After a while, he continued to say, "For me, the owner of the letters should be … a very important person, right?"

Gu Yusheng's voice was very low, as if he were asking himself.

Lu Bancheng didn't hear him clearly. "Hmm?"

Gu Yusheng was awakened by the noise. He shook his head at Lu Bancheng and said, "Nothing." Then he continued to look at the computer.

Lu Bancheng could see that Gu Yusheng didn't want to talk about the "pen pal letters," so he shut his mouth and took out his cell phone to watch the football game. After a few minutes, his cell phone vibrated in his hand.

As the ringtone rang, the football game was overshadowed by the caller ID. Lu Bancheng couldn't help but complain, "Who is it? The football game is so intense!"

As he said this, he glanced at the caller ID and said casually, "Xiaokou?"

Gu Yusheng, who was working hard in front of the computer, raised his eyebrows when he heard the name "Xiaokou." His fingers on the keyboard were not as smooth as before.

Lu Bancheng was probably afraid that answering the phone would disturb him, so he stood up with the phone in his hand and answered it. As he walked, he called out, "Xiaokou, why did you suddenly call me? … Treat me to a meal? … "

Even though Lu Bancheng had walked some distance away, Gu Yusheng could still hear his voice clearly. Gu Yusheng gradually stopped typing on the keyboard and became less focused, paying more attention to Lu Bancheng's voice.

"You have business with me? You want my help? Sure … tell me … No no no, I'm not busy right now … "

Did Liang Doukou call Lu Bancheng to ask him for help?

Gu Yusheng's eyes became a little indifferent. His eyebrows flashed, and without thinking, he exited the email on the desktop and clicked on an application. After a few seconds, Lu Bancheng's work phone on the coffee table rang, followed by his home phone.
